Dallas Texas Transition Agreement is a legally binding agreement that outlines the terms and conditions for transferring ownership or transitioning the responsibility of a particular asset, business, or property in Dallas, Texas. It serves as a comprehensive agreement between parties involved in the transition process, ensuring a smooth and hassle-free change of ownership or control. The Dallas Texas Transition Agreement typically includes detailed clauses pertaining to the transfer of assets, rights, obligations, liabilities, and related matters. It outlines the agreed-upon timeframe, procedures, and steps to be followed during the transition process, ensuring that all parties involved are aware of their roles and responsibilities. There are several types of Dallas Texas Transition Agreements, each designed for specific purposes. Some of these agreements include: 1. Business Transition Agreement: This type of agreement is commonly used when transitioning the ownership or control of a business in Dallas, Texas. It outlines the terms and conditions related to the transfer of assets, employees, contracts, intellectual property rights, and other relevant aspects. 2. Property Transition Agreement: When transitioning the ownership or control of a property, such as a residential or commercial building in Dallas, Texas, a property transition agreement is used. It specifies the terms of the transfer, including lease agreements, property titles, maintenance responsibilities, and any other pertinent details. 3. Employment Transition Agreement: In cases where an employee's role or responsibilities are being transferred or changed, an employment transition agreement is utilized. It outlines the terms and conditions of the employee's transition, including salary adjustments, benefits, job descriptions, and other relevant matters. 4. Asset Transition Agreement: When transferring ownership or control of specific assets, such as equipment, vehicles, or inventory, an asset transition agreement is used. This agreement lays out the terms and conditions for the transfer, including asset valuation, payment terms, warranties, and any relevant legal considerations. In conclusion, the Dallas Texas Transition Agreement is a vital legal document used to facilitate a smooth transfer of ownership or control in various contexts. Whether it involves a business, property, employee, or assets, the agreement ensures that all parties involved are aware of their rights and obligations, minimizing potential disputes or complications during the transition process.
